CCU is now up and running. Double checking my fuses solved it. I was actually glad to see an 8 amp fuse blown. The location was supposed to have a 16 amp in it.
When in doubt about fuse locations you can always refer to the numbers actually on the fuse block and match those to the fuse road map page inside the fuse cover.
